Quick Summary

The 2025 Ford F-150 HYBRID has 26 owner complaints filed with NHTSA — that's 0.2x the segment average of 140. The most common issue is brakes problems (23% of all complaints), specifically: brakes failed on my 2025 f150 and several abs and brake system alarms came in. the problem went away on its own. i took the truck to my dealer and was told ford is aware of the problem and does not have a fix. no other advice was given.. There are 2 recalls issued for this model year.

Recalls (2)

ELECTRICAL SYSTEM:PROPULSION SYSTEM:FUSES, RELAYS, CONTACTS, AND SHUNTS28/03/2025

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2025 F-150 full hybrid electric (FHEV) vehicles. The high voltage battery junction box may contain an incorrect fuse, which can fail and result in a sudden loss of drive power.

Risk: A sudden loss of drive power increases the risk of a crash.

Fix: Dealers will replace the incorrect 60-amp fuse with a 150-amp fuse,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ed April 11, 2025.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 25S29.
